Atlas Shrugged Online Text

Atlas Shrugged is a novel by Ayn Rand that was published in 1957. It is a philosophical novel that presents the author's Objectivist philosophy. The novel is set in a dystopian United States where the government has taken control of all industries.

The Plot of Atlas Shrugged

The plot of Atlas Shrugged revolves around the character of Dagny Taggart, who is a successful railroad executive. Dagny struggles to keep her business afloat in a world where the government is taking control of all industries. She meets a man named John Galt, who is leading a strike of the most successful people in the world against the government.

The strike is based on the idea that if the successful people in the world withdraw their talents and abilities from the world, the government will be unable to function. The strike is successful and the government collapses, leaving the successful people to rebuild society on their own terms.

Why Read Atlas Shrugged?

Atlas Shrugged is a novel that presents a unique and controversial philosophy. The Objectivist philosophy presented in the novel is based on the idea of individualism and the importance of self-interest. The novel presents a critique of socialism and collectivism and argues that the only way to achieve a free and prosperous society is through individualism and laissez-faire capitalism.

Reading Atlas Shrugged can be a great way to explore these ideas and to gain a better understanding of the Objectivist philosophy. It can also be a great way to gain a deeper appreciation for the importance of individualism and the free market in society.
